How many inches is 1 mm?

One millimeter is 0.03937 inches, so divide millimeters by 25.4. The inch has been exactly 25.4 mm since the 1959 International Yard and Pound Agreement, which makes this conversion exact rather than approximate. 100 mm is 3.94 inches, and 25.4 mm is one inch on the nose.

Below about 50 mm the answer is far more useful as a fraction than a decimal, because that is how drill bits, wrenches and stock sizes are labelled.

The formula, worked line by line

The inch is defined in metric terms, and it has been for longer than most people assume. The chain runs from the yard: fix the yard at 0.9144 meters, divide by 36 to get the inch at 0.0254 meters, and multiply by a thousand to state it in millimeters. That gives 25.4, exactly, with nothing after it.

The avoirdupois pound is exactly 0.45359237 kilograms; the yard is exactly 0.9144 meters.
International Yard and Pound Agreement, 1959

Because 25.4 is exact, the inch is a metric unit wearing imperial clothes. Any conversion between the two systems in either direction is a single division or multiplication with no approximation involved, which is precisely why international manufacturing tolerated the two systems side by side for as long as it did.

One hundred millimeters is a useful anchor because it sits so close to four inches without reaching it. The gap is 1.6 mm, about a sixteenth of an inch, which is enough to leave a visible step where a metric panel meets an imperial opening and enough to stop a 100 mm part dropping into a 4 inch hole cut to size.

The mental version

Divide by 25 instead of 25.4 and you have the answer within 1.6 percent, always on the high side. One hundred millimeters becomes 4 inches against a true 3.937, and 50 mm becomes 2 against 1.969. That is close enough to picture the size and never close enough to cut to.

Reading the fraction correctly

To reach a fraction, multiply the decimal inches by 64, round to a whole number, and put it over 64. Ten millimeters gives 0.3937 times 64, which is 25.2, so 25/64. That does not reduce, which is the tell: a metric size that lands on an unreduceable sixty-fourth has no natural fractional equivalent at all.

Sizes that reduce are easier to remember, but only one is a genuine crossover. Three millimeters rounds to 8/64, which reduces to 1/8, though the true gap is 0.175 mm. Nineteen rounds to 48/64, which reduces to 3/4, and there the gap is only 0.05 mm. That second pair is the one you can actually substitute.

The reason this conversion feels harder than it is comes down to notation. Metric sizes are whole numbers and imperial sizes are fractions, so the answer to a millimeter question is almost never a tidy figure. Ten millimeters is 0.3937 inches, which is close to three eighths and not equal to it.

Near means the closest sixty-fourth, not an equivalent. Only 25.4 mm is exactly an inch.

Small sizes are where the mismatch bites hardest, because the fractional ladder gets coarse fast. Between 1/16 and 1/8 of an inch there is nothing but 3/32, a gap of 1.5875 mm, so a metric size landing in the middle has no fractional neighbour worth using and has to stay a decimal.

Which imperial wrench fits a metric nut

Every mixed toolbox eventually faces the same question: can this imperial socket turn that metric fastener without rounding it off. The answer is arithmetic, not luck. Convert the fraction to millimeters, compare it with the nut, and look at the sign and size of the gap.

A fraction larger than the nut will go on and may be loose enough to slip. A fraction smaller than the nut will not go on at all. The only pairing that is genuinely interchangeable across the common range is 3/4 inch against 19 mm, where the wrench is 19.05 mm and the gap is five hundredths of a millimeter.

Imperial wrench against the nearest metric nut
3/8 in is 9.53 mm, on a 10 mm nut
0.48 mm too small
7/16 in is 11.11 mm, on an 11 mm nut
0.11 mm loose
1/2 in is 12.70 mm, on a 13 mm nut
0.30 mm too small
9/16 in is 14.29 mm, on a 14 mm nut
0.29 mm loose
3/4 in is 19.05 mm, on a 19 mm nut
0.05 mm loose
7/8 in is 22.23 mm, on a 22 mm nut
0.23 mm loose

Every figure is the fraction multiplied by 25.4 and compared with the nominal metric size.

The practical reading is that a quarter of a millimeter of slop is enough to round a soft fastener under load, so the loose pairings are for a nut you can already turn by hand. Anything seized, anything on an engine, and anything with a torque spec deserves the right socket rather than the near one.

Millimeters, thousandths and drawing tolerances

Machinists working in inches do not use fractions for tolerance. They use the thousandth of an inch, spoken as a thou and written 0.001 in. One thou is exactly 0.0254 mm, or 25.4 micrometers, which means a millimeter is 39.37 thou and a tenth of a millimeter is just under four thou.

That relationship is the one worth carrying, because tolerance blocks on a metric drawing are written in hundredths of a millimeter. A tolerance of plus or minus 0.05 mm is about two thou. A tolerance of 0.01 mm is four tenths of a thou, which is finer than most shop measurement and tells you the feature needs grinding rather than milling.

Sheet and plate stock shows the same split. Metric sheet comes in whole and half millimeter thicknesses while imperial stock follows gauge numbers and fractions, so a 1.5 mm sheet is 0.0591 inches and sits between the imperial gauges rather than on one. Substituting the nearest gauge changes stiffness, which goes as the cube of thickness.
